Piteå vs Santarem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Piteå, Sweden and Santarem, Brazil is approximately 9,616 km or 5,975 mi.
  • To reach Piteå in this distance one would set out from Santarem bearing 24°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Piteå bearing 76.4° or ENE .
  • Piteå has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c) whereas Santarem has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
  • The average temperature is 23.5 °C (42.2°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 24.5 °C (44.1°F) more in Piteå.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1458 mm (57.4 in) less which is equivalent to 1458 l/m² (35.78 US gal/ft²) or 14,580,000 l/ha (1,558,699 US gal/ac) less. About 1/4 as much.
  • There are 150 fewer hours of sunlight per year in Piteå. In whichever way circa 0h 24' less per day or about 1 as many.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 49.7° lower in Piteå than in Santarem.
